Matthew 23:31-39 Amplified Bible (AMP)

31. Thus you are testifying against yourselves that you are the descendants of those who murdered the prophets.

32. Fill up, then, the measure of your fathers' sins to the brim [so that nothing may be wanting to a full measure].

33. You serpents! You spawn of vipers! How can you escape the penalty to be suffered in hell (Gehenna)?

34. Because of this, take notice: I am sending you prophets and wise men (interpreters and teachers) and scribes (men learned in the Mosaic Law and the Prophets); some of them you will kill, even crucify, and some you will flog in your synagogues and pursue and persecute from town to town,

35. So that upon your heads may come all the blood of the righteous (those who correspond to the divine standard of right) shed on earth, from the blood of the righteous Abel to the blood of Zechariah son of Barachiah, whom you murdered between the sanctuary and the altar [of burnt offering]. [Gen. 4:8; II Chron. 24:21.]

36. Truly I declare to you, all these [evil, calamitous times] will come upon this generation. [II Chron. 36:15, 16.]

37. O Jerusalem, Jerusalem, murdering the prophets and stoning those who are sent to you! How often would I have gathered your children together as a mother fowl gathers her brood under her wings, and you refused!

38. Behold, your house is forsaken and desolate (abandoned and left destitute of God's help). [I Kings 9:7; Jer. 22:5.]

39. For I declare to you, you will not see Me again until you say, Blessed (magnified in worship, adored, and exalted) is He Who comes in the name of the Lord! [Ps. 118:26.]
